Создание текстового поля как типа массива в CakePHP

0

Код CakePHP

<?php echo $this->Form->hidden("name",array("value"=>$table['name']));?>

Вывод кода выше

<input type="hidden" id="KPIName" value="Customer Acquisition" name="data[KPI][name]">

Но я хочу, чтобы результат

<input type="hidden" id="KPIName" value="Customer Acquisition" name="data[KPI][name][]">

Как я могу достичь в CakePHP? Благодарю.

Теги:
cakephp

1 ответ

1
Лучший ответ

Попробуйте -

<?php echo $this->Form->hidden("name.",array("value"=>$table['name']));?>
  • 0
    Ваш код генерирует следующий вывод: <input type="hidden" id="KPIName[]" value="Customer Acquisition" name="data[KPI][name[]]">
  • 0
    добавить точку . , Обновил ответ
Показать ещё 4 комментария

Ещё вопросы

Сообщество Overcoder
Наверх
Меню